Нажатия клавиш для управляющих кодов ASCII

Я собирался порекомендовать попробовать использовать что-то вроде rsync для определения списка отсутствующих / различных файлов, а затем использовать этот список. Однако это не сработает с вашими потребностями.

Вы также можете рассмотреть возможность использования find для помощи с возможной рекурсией. Даже сравнение файлов из двух каталогов с помощью некоторых команд sed и grep может дать вам список файлов, который вы хотите.

1
12.10.2016, 19:50
3 ответа

Нажатия клавиш для дополнительных управляющих символов следующие:

^[ - Escape
^\ - File Separator
^] - Group Separator
^^ - Record Separator
^_ - Unit Separator

telnet использует разделитель групп в качестве выхода к своему интерактивному интерфейсу. Поскольку escape-символ часто используется в терминальных приложениях, он обычно пересылается на дальнюю сторону, с которой установлено соединение telnet.

2
27.01.2020, 23:19

Раньше, когда клавиатуры отправляли коды ASCII непосредственно на порт клавиатуры, да,Control плюс буквенные клавиши и шесть других создали управляющие коды ASCII. На микроконтроллерах типа IBM -клавиатура выдает скан-коды, а BIOS или ОС сообщают об этом и о соответствующих ASCII-кодах (, управляющих или графических )приложениям.

0
27.01.2020, 23:19

Упс --мой предыдущий пост не был хорошим ответом. По крайней мере, в Linux код ASCII, сообщаемый для клавиши ESC, действительно такой же, как для Ctrl -[, а для Enter такой же, как для Ctrl -M. Для Backspace, Ctrl -? Сообщается (DEL ), а для Ctrl -Backspace сообщается Ctrl -H (BS ), но они делают то же самое. Для клавиши Delete сообщается Escape-последовательность ANSI.

0
27.01.2020, 23:19

Теги

Похожие вопросы